  • 5. WHAT’S ON YOUR 
 ONLINE APPLICATION FORM? - 3 questions about your startup/team - 3-minute application video - Founder details (this won’t take too long)
  • 6. 3 QUESTIONS ABOUT
 YOUR STARTUP/TEAM 1. In 1-3 sentences, describe what your startup does. 2. Please list your startup’s top 3 achievements / milestones. 3. In 1-2 sentences, what is it about your team that demonstrates your ability to succeed?

  • 12. W H AT I S A G O O D P I T C H ?
  • 13. 1. PROBLEM 2. SOLUTION 3. MARKET 4. TRACTION 5. COMPETITION 6. BUSINESS MODEL 7. TEAM 8. THE WAY FORWARD PITCH FORMAT <<Don’t go over time! You will be cut off! >> These are guidelines (Not prescriptive).
  • 14. Introduction • Introduce yourself • One sentence 
 elevator pitch • Traction teaser
 (if you have it) What the 
 problem/opp. is What is your market? • What is the problem
 you solve? • Do you have a deep understanding of this problem? • What’s your solution? • Is your solution well validated? • Who uses your product? • Why do people need
 your product? • How big is the market? • Is the market large and/or growing? • Is your understanding of the market accurate and complete? • Why is now the right time? CHECKLIST This applies to both your pitch & interview
  • 15. Who you are • What about the
 founders will allow
 this startup to 
 succeed? • How well do the
 founders work 
 together? Business model 
 and growth How and why 
 you can win • What else is out there? • Why are you better? • What’s your traction/ progress to date? • How big can this get? • How far will you be by 
 the end of MAP? • Do you have a viable and well-understood revenue or funding model? • How will you grow and achieve scale? CHECKLIST This applies to both your pitch & interview
  • 16. BE PREPARED Know your market • Especially at the interview • Know your customers and competitors
 better than anyone Prepare your facts • The most 
 important insights about your business How do you make 
 money? • Know how you will make it or find it • Know what you’ll do with it • CAC vs LTV is usually important • It’s okay to do 
 things that don’t 
 scale at the beginning! Think about 
 traction/validation This applies to both your pitch & interview
  • 17. PITCH STYLE Be enthusiastic • Preferably very
 enthusiastic Where is your team? • Preferably in the room • Preferably silent after intros • Probably worse speakers than you Keep it simple! • Don’t give me options • Don’t attack me with data Be knowledgable • Especially about your market & customers or beneficiaries • Avoid anecdotes/ buzz words Ditch the script! • Avoid cue cards • Avoid video • Keep it succinct Deck-to-speech ratio • Can distract the audience
